Food Truck Comida Mexicana isn’t a monolithic cuisine. The flavors will vary significantly based on the region they draw inspiration from.

Consider the vibrant cuisine of Oaxaca, known for its complex moles, tlayudas (oversized tortillas topped with a variety of ingredients), and unique cheeses. A Food Truck Comida Mexicana specializing in Oaxacan cuisine might offer tlayudas topped with asiento (pork lard), black beans, quesillo cheese, and a choice of meat. Or picture the bright, citrus-infused flavors of the Yucatan Peninsula, reflected in dishes like cochinita pibil (slow-roasted pork marinated in achiote paste) and sopa de lima (lime soup). A Yucatecan food truck might serve tacos filled with cochinita pibil, accompanied by pickled onions and habanero salsa.

Then there are the ubiquitous tacos al pastor – thinly sliced pork marinated in a chili-based adobo, cooked on a vertical spit, and served in small corn tortillas with pineapple, cilantro, and onions. The simple presentation belies the complex flavors and meticulous preparation that go into this iconic dish.

Other dishes well-suited for the Food Truck Comida Mexicana format include:

  • Elotes: Grilled corn on the cob, slathered in mayonnaise, cotija cheese, chili powder, and lime juice.
  • Tortas: Mexican sandwiches filled with a variety of meats, cheeses, and vegetables.
  • Quesadillas: Grilled tortillas filled with cheese and other ingredients.
  • Tamales: Steamed corn husk packets filled with savory or sweet fillings.

Delving Deeper: Beyond the Usual Suspects

While tacos and burritos are undeniably popular, Food Truck Comida Mexicana offers a wealth of other equally delicious dishes waiting to be discovered. Prepare to expand your culinary horizons.

Unveiling the Hidden Gems

Venture beyond the familiar and explore the hidden gems of Food Truck Comida Mexicana. You might discover:

  • Huaraches: Oblong-shaped masa cakes topped with beans, cheese, salsa, and your choice of meat. Their shape resembles a sandal (huarache in Spanish)
  • Tlayudas: Large, crispy tortillas topped with a variety of ingredients, often including asiento, black beans, quesillo cheese, and your choice of meat. Think of it as a Mexican pizza.
  • Esquites: A delicious street food snack made with grilled corn kernels, mayonnaise, cotija cheese, chili powder, and lime juice. It’s served in a cup and eaten with a spoon.
  • Sopes: Thick, small masa cakes topped with beans, cheese, salsa, and your choice of meat.
  • Tamales: Steamed corn husk packets filled with savory or sweet fillings.

These dishes represent just a small sampling of the diverse culinary landscape of Mexico. Food Truck Comida Mexicana provides an opportunity to experience these regional specialties without having to travel across the country.

Plant-Based Power: Vegetarian and Vegan Delights

The growing demand for vegetarian and vegan options has not gone unnoticed by the Food Truck Comida Mexicana scene. More and more food trucks are offering delicious and satisfying plant-based alternatives to traditional meat-heavy dishes.

Cactus tacos (nopales), featuring tender grilled cactus pads marinated in spices, are a popular vegetarian option. Mushroom quesadillas (huitlacoche), filled with the earthy, truffle-like flavor of corn smut, are another culinary delight. Vegan elotes, made with plant-based mayonnaise and cheese alternatives, offer a cruelty-free take on a classic street food snack.

These vegetarian and vegan options demonstrate the versatility of Mexican cuisine and its ability to cater to a variety of dietary needs and preferences.

The Right Place at the Right Time

Finding Food Truck Comida Mexicana often involves a bit of detective work. Many food trucks operate on a rotating schedule, appearing at different locations throughout the week. Food truck parks, festivals, and street corners are all common gathering places.

Fortunately, technology has made it easier than ever to track down your favorite food trucks. A variety of apps and websites, such as Roaming Hunger and StreetFoodFinder, allow you to search for food trucks by location, cuisine, and schedule.

Listen to the Crowd: The Power of Reviews

Before committing to a particular Food Truck Comida Mexicana, take the time to read online reviews and seek recommendations from locals. Websites like Yelp and Google Reviews provide valuable insights into the quality of the food, the friendliness of the staff, and the overall dining experience.

Pay attention to what other customers are saying about specific dishes, and look for patterns in the reviews. Consistent praise for a particular item is a good indication that it’s worth trying.

Local food blogs and social media groups can also be valuable resources for finding hidden gems and discovering new Food Truck Comida Mexicana businesses.
